This podcast is a conversation with Willem Toet, Head of Aerodynamics at the Benetton team in 1994.I wanted to talk with Willem to understand exactly what was going on in the team at the time, whether the allegations of cheating with traction control and launch control were true, and what was really going on underneath Benetton’s engine cover.

How Students Built a Car That Does 0-100 in 0.9 Sec
This podcast is a conversation with Eloi Roset from team AMZ Racing, who recently broke the 0 - 100 kilometres an hour record, launching from a standing start to 100 kph in 0.956 seconds. We break down how the team designed and built the world's fastest-accelerating car and the challenges they ran into. Eloi explains the details of the aerodynamics, suspension, powertrain and tyres, and it’s a fascinating conversation.
